Spirit Airlines operates a fleet primarily composed of Airbus A320 family aircraft. This selection allows the airline to maintain efficiency and cost-effectiveness, catering to its low-cost business model while ensuring passenger comfort.
Spirit Airlines Aircraft Model Breakdown
Spirit Airlines focuses on a streamlined fleet to optimize operational efficiency. The airline primarily utilizes Airbus A319, A320, and A321 models. These aircraft are known for their fuel efficiency and capacity, making them suitable for both short and medium-haul routes.
Airbus A319 Performance and Capacity Details
The Airbus A319 is a key component of Spirit Airlines’ fleet, known for its efficiency and capacity to accommodate a growing number of passengers. This aircraft combines performance with cost-effectiveness, making it an ideal choice for the airline’s route structure. Understanding its specifications provides insight into how Spirit Airlines maintains its operational goals.
The Airbus A319 is a compact aircraft that offers a balance of performance and capacity. It typically accommodates around 145 passengers in an all-economy configuration. Key specifications include:
| Specification | Value |
|---|---|
| Length | 33.84 m |
| Wingspan | 34.1 m |
| Maximum Range | 3,750 km |
| Cruising Speed | 840 km/h |
The A319 is ideal for shorter routes, providing a comfortable travel experience while maintaining operational cost-effectiveness.
Spirit Airlines Airbus A320 Specifications
Spirit Airlines primarily operates the Airbus A320, a popular choice for low-cost carriers due to its efficiency and capacity. This aircraft is designed for short to medium-haul flights, offering a balance of performance and comfort that aligns with Spirit’s budget-friendly model. Understanding its specifications provides insight into the airline’s operational capabilities and passenger experience.
The Airbus A320 serves as the backbone of Spirit’s fleet. It can carry approximately 180 passengers and is designed for high-density routes. Notable features include:
| Feature | Detail |
|---|---|
| Length | 37.57 m |
| Wingspan | 34.1 m |
| Maximum Range | 6,300 km |
| Cruising Speed | 840 km/h |
The A320’s versatility makes it suitable for various route lengths, supporting Spirit’s extensive network.
Airbus A321 Benefits for High-Demand Routes
The Airbus A321 has become a vital asset for Spirit Airlines, particularly on high-demand routes. Its capacity and efficiency make it well-suited for busy travel corridors, allowing the airline to maximize passenger numbers while maintaining cost-effectiveness. Understanding the advantages of this aircraft can provide insights into Spirit’s operational strategies and customer service offerings.
The Airbus A321 is the largest member of the A320 family, accommodating up to 230 passengers. This aircraft is particularly effective for high-demand routes. Key advantages include:
| Advantage | Description |
|---|---|
| Increased Capacity | Higher passenger load allows for more revenue per flight |
| Extended Range | Capable of flying longer distances, expanding route options |
| Fuel Efficiency | Advanced engines reduce fuel consumption |
The A321 enhances Spirit’s ability to serve busy routes while maximizing profitability.
